Greek Tourism Travels To Scandinavia Next Year
The best of Greece – tourism, gastronomy and culture – will be hosted under one roof next year in Sweden at the first dedicated travel and taste fair for Greece “Grekland Panorama.”
Grekland Panorama will take place 14-16 February 2014 at venue Globe Arenas, Annexete, located in the heart of Stockholm, the buzzing capital of Scandinavia. Globe Arenas is visited daily by tens of thousands of people.
The fair will feature a number of Greek hotels, travel agencies, destinations, services, real estate, traditional Greek gastronomy, tastings and more.
The main aim of Grekland Panorama is to give an innovative and dynamic presentation of Greece and its tourism product to tourism professionals and the public in the Nordic markets.
According to data, over 1.5 million visitors from the Nordic markets visit Greece on an annual basis.
Grekland Panorama
The first day of the fair, 14 February, will be open exclusively for professionals. Scheduled B2B meetings will take place between Greek tourism professionals and tour operators, travel agencies and airlines that are active in the Nordic markets.
Later in the evening, the official inauguration ceremony of Grekland Panorama will take place. Organizers promise a “Greek Night” with special guests that will include celebrities, politicians and representatives of the tourism and business world of Sweden.
On 15-16 February the fair will be open to the public (free of charge) who will enter an exhibition space filled with images, sounds and flavors of Greece, with numerous parallel events, competitions and activities for all.
Grekland Panorama is organized by North Events, a company specializing in promoting Greek tourism, gastronomy and culture in the Scandinavian market.
The fair is supported by the Hellenic Chamber of Hotels, the Hellenic Federation of Hoteliers, the Greek Tourism Ministry, the Greek National Tourism Organization and leading tour operators in Scandinavia such as Apollo Kuoni, TUI Fritidsresor, VING, Airtours, Tema Resor etc.
